Best Salt Lake County Public Schools (2025)

For the 2025 school year, there are 323 public schools serving 208,999 students in Salt Lake County, UT (there are 89 private schools, serving 13,676 private students). 94% of all K-12 students in Salt Lake County, UT are educated in public schools (compared to the UT state average of 97%).
The top ranked public schools in Salt Lake County, UT are Sunrise School, Cottonwood School and Howard R. Driggs School. Overall testing rank is based on a school's combined math and reading proficiency test score ranking.
Salt Lake County, UT public schools have an average math proficiency score of 36% (versus the Utah public school average of 40%), and reading proficiency score of 40% (versus the 43% statewide average). Schools in Salt Lake County have an average ranking of 4/10, which is in the bottom 50% of Utah public schools.
Minority enrollment is 41% of the student body (majority Hispanic), which is more than the Utah public school average of 29% (majority Hispanic).

Best Public Schools in Salt Lake County (2025)

School
(Math and Reading Proficiency)
Location
Quick Facts
Rank: #11.
Sunrise School
(Math: 81% | Reading: 80%)
Rank:
10/
10
Top 1%
1520 E 11265 S
Sandy, UT 84092
(801) 826-9550
Gr: K-5 | 669 students Student-Teacher Ratio: 22:1 Minority enrollment: 25%
Rank: #22.
Cottonwood School
(Math: 84% | Reading: 74%)
Rank:
10/
10
Top 1%
5205 Holladay Blvd
Salt Lake City, UT 84117
(385) 646-4798
Gr: PK-6 | 343 students Student-Teacher Ratio: 19:1 Minority enrollment: 11%
Rank: #33.
Howard R. Driggs School
(Math: 80% | Reading: 75%)
Rank:
10/
10
Top 1%
4340 S 2700 E
Salt Lake City, UT 84124
(385) 646-4810
Gr: PK-6 | 482 students Student-Teacher Ratio: 27:1 Minority enrollment: 11%
Rank: #44.
Peruvian Park School
(Math: 75% | Reading: 77%)
Rank:
10/
10
Top 1%
1545 E 8425 S
Sandy, UT 84093
(801) 826-9100
Gr: K-5 | 544 students Student-Teacher Ratio: 23:1 Minority enrollment: 31%
Rank: #55.
Eastwood School
(Math: 80-84% | Reading: 65-69%)
Rank:
10/
10
Top 1%
3305 Wasatch Blvd
Salt Lake City, UT 84109
(385) 646-4816
Gr: PK-5 | 314 students Student-Teacher Ratio: 24:1 Minority enrollment: 20%
Rank: #66.
Uintah School
(Math: 81% | Reading: 67%)
Rank:
10/
10
Top 5%
1571 E 1300 S
Salt Lake City, UT 84105
(801) 584-2940
Gr: K-6 | 422 students Student-Teacher Ratio: 21:1 Minority enrollment: 26%
Rank: #77.
Oakridge School
(Math: 75-79% | Reading: 65-69%)
Rank:
10/
10
Top 5%
4325 S Jupiter Dr
Salt Lake City, UT 84124
(385) 646-4936
Gr: K-5 | 300 students Student-Teacher Ratio: 25:1 Minority enrollment: 17%
Rank: #88.
Bonneville School
(Math: 71% | Reading: 70%)
Rank:
10/
10
Top 5%
1145 S 1900 E
Salt Lake City, UT 84108
(801) 584-2913
Gr: K-6 | 429 students Student-Teacher Ratio: 20:1 Minority enrollment: 17%
Rank: #9 - 109. - 10.
Ensign School
(Math: 70-74% | Reading: 65-69%)
Rank:
10/
10
Top 5%
775 - 12th Ave
Salt Lake City, UT 84103
(801) 578-8150
Gr: PK-6 | 311 students Student-Teacher Ratio: 19:1 Minority enrollment: 22%
Rank: #9 - 109. - 10.
Willow Canyon School
(Math: 70-74% | Reading: 65-69%)
Rank:
10/
10
Top 5%
9650 S 1700 E
Sandy, UT 84092
(801) 826-9625
Gr: K-5 | 365 students Student-Teacher Ratio: 18:1 Minority enrollment: 21%
Rank: #1111.
Beacon Heights School
(Math: 71% | Reading: 68%)
Rank:
10/
10
Top 5%
1850 S 2500 E
Salt Lake City, UT 84108
(801) 481-4814
Gr: PK-6 | 372 students Student-Teacher Ratio: 18:1 Minority enrollment: 32%
Rank: #1212.
Lone Peak School
(Math: 76% | Reading: 65%)
Rank:
10/
10
Top 5%
11515 S 2220 E
Sandy, UT 84092
(801) 826-8650
Gr: K-5 | 543 students Student-Teacher Ratio: 21:1 Minority enrollment: 21%
Rank: #13 - 1413. - 14.
Brookwood School
(Math: 76% | Reading: 63%)
Rank:
10/
10
Top 5%
8640 S 2565 E
Sandy, UT 84093
(801) 826-7900
Gr: K-5 | 362 students Student-Teacher Ratio: 23:1 Minority enrollment: 13%
Rank: #13 - 1413. - 14.
Indian Hills School
(Math: 75-79% | Reading: 60-64%)
Rank:
10/
10
Top 5%
2496 E Saint Marys Dr
Salt Lake City, UT 84108
(801) 584-2908
Gr: PK-6 | 326 students Student-Teacher Ratio: 19:1 Minority enrollment: 23%
Rank: #1515.
Draper School
Magnet School
(Math: 70% | Reading: 64%)
Rank:
10/
10
Top 5%
1080 E 12660 S
Draper, UT 84020
(801) 826-8275
Gr: K-5 | 696 students Student-Teacher Ratio: 22:1 Minority enrollment: 20%
Rank: #1616.
Oakwood School
(Math: 65-69% | Reading: 63%)
Rank:
10/
10
Top 5%
5815 S Highland Dr
Salt Lake City, UT 84121
(385) 646-4942
Gr: PK-6 | 579 students Student-Teacher Ratio: 29:1 Minority enrollment: 27%
Rank: #1717.
Morningside School
(Math: 72% | Reading: 60%)
Rank:
10/
10
Top 5%
4170 S 3000 E
Salt Lake City, UT 84124
(385) 646-4924
Gr: K-6 | 585 students Student-Teacher Ratio: 23:1 Minority enrollment: 23%
Rank: #1818.
Albion Middle School
(Math: 62% | Reading: 70%)
Rank:
10/
10
Top 5%
2755 E 8890 S
Sandy, UT 84093
(801) 826-6700
Gr: 6-8 | 945 students Student-Teacher Ratio: 24:1 Minority enrollment: 14%
Rank: #1919.
Canyon Rim Academy
Charter School
(Math: 69% | Reading: 61%)
Rank:
10/
10
Top 5%
3005 S 2900 E
Salt Lake City, UT 84109
(801) 474-2066
Gr: K-6 | 520 students Student-Teacher Ratio: 23:1 Minority enrollment: 14%
Rank: #2020.
Canyon View School
(Math: 73% | Reading: 59%)
Rank:
10/
10
Top 5%
3050 E 7800 S
Salt Lake City, UT 84121
(801) 826-8050
Gr: K-5 | 478 students Student-Teacher Ratio: 21:1 Minority enrollment: 19%
Rank: #2121.
Oakdale School
(Math: 60-64% | Reading: 65-69%)
Rank:
10/
10
Top 5%
1900 E 8100 S
Sandy, UT 84093
(801) 826-8950
Gr: K-5 | 350 students Student-Teacher Ratio: 19:1 Minority enrollment: 24%
Rank: #2222.
Butler School
(Math: 64% | Reading: 64%)
Rank:
10/
10
Top 5%
2700 E 7000 S
Salt Lake City, UT 84121
(801) 826-7975
Gr: K-5 | 610 students Student-Teacher Ratio: 23:1 Minority enrollment: 18%
Rank: #2323.
Herriman School
(Math: 71% | Reading: 59%)
Rank:
10/
10
Top 5%
13170 S 6000 W
Herriman, UT 84096
(801) 446-3215
Gr: K-6 | 712 students Student-Teacher Ratio: 22:1 Minority enrollment: 23%
Rank: #24 - 2524. - 25.
Park Lane School
(Math: 77% | Reading: 55-59%)
Rank:
10/
10
Top 10%
9955 S 2300 E
Sandy, UT 84092
(801) 826-9025
Gr: K-5 | 343 students Student-Teacher Ratio: 19:1 Minority enrollment: 16%
Rank: #24 - 2524. - 25.
William Penn School
(Math: 68% | Reading: 60%)
Rank:
10/
10
Top 10%
1670 Siggard Dr
Salt Lake City, UT 84106
(385) 646-4960
Gr: K-6 | 666 students Student-Teacher Ratio: 27:1 Minority enrollment: 19%
Rank: #2626.
Quail Hollow School
(Math: 63% | Reading: 61%)
Rank:
10/
10
Top 10%
2625 E 9070 S
Sandy, UT 84093
(801) 826-9175
Gr: K-5 | 402 students Student-Teacher Ratio: 20:1 Minority enrollment: 15%
Rank: #2727.
Woodstock School
(Math: 62% | Reading: 60%)
Rank:
10/
10
Top 10%
6015 S 1300 E
Salt Lake City, UT 84121
(385) 646-5108
Gr: PK-6 | 633 students Student-Teacher Ratio: 25:1 Minority enrollment: 29%
Rank: #2828.
Upland Terrace School
(Math: 64% | Reading: 58%)
Rank:
10/
10
Top 10%
3700 S 2860 E
Salt Lake City, UT 84109
(385) 646-5055
Gr: PK-5 | 511 students Student-Teacher Ratio: 23:1 Minority enrollment: 13%
Rank: #2929.
Butler Middle School
(Math: 59% | Reading: 64%)
Rank:
10/
10
Top 10%
7530 S 2700 E
Salt Lake City, UT 84121
(801) 826-6800
Gr: 6-8 | 904 students Student-Teacher Ratio: 23:1 Minority enrollment: 27%
Rank: #3030.
Draper Park Middle School
(Math: 59% | Reading: 63%)
Rank:
10/
10
Top 10%
13133 South 1300 East
Draper, UT 84020
(801) 826-6900
Gr: 6-8 | 1,481 student Student-Teacher Ratio: 25:1 Minority enrollment: 21%
Rank: #3131.
Mcmillan School
(Math: 61% | Reading: 60%)
Rank:
10/
10
Top 10%
315 E 5900 S
Salt Lake City, UT 84107
(801) 264-7430
Gr: K-6 | 459 students Student-Teacher Ratio: 23:1 Minority enrollment: 30%
Rank: #3232.
Jordan Ridge School
(Math: 59% | Reading: 60%)
Rank:
10/
10
Top 10%
2636 W 9800 S
South Jordan, UT 84095
(801) 254-8025
Gr: K-6 | 654 students Student-Teacher Ratio: 20:1 Minority enrollment: 22%
Rank: #3333.
Wasatch School
(Math: 60-64% | Reading: 56%)
Rank:
10/
10
Top 10%
30 R Street
Salt Lake City, UT 84103
(801) 578-8564
Gr: K-6 | 332 students Student-Teacher Ratio: 21:1 Minority enrollment: 36%
Rank: #3434.
Granite School
(Math: 70% | Reading: 50-54%)
Rank:
10/
10
Top 10%
9760 S 3100 E
Sandy, UT 84092
(801) 826-8575
Gr: K-5 | 324 students Student-Teacher Ratio: 18:1 Minority enrollment: 15%
Rank: #3535.
Academy For Math Engineering & Science
Magnet School
Charter School
(Math: 53% | Reading: 70-74%)
Rank:
10/
10
Top 10%
5715 S 1300 E
Salt Lake City, UT 84121
(801) 278-9460
Gr: 9-12 | 469 students Student-Teacher Ratio: 20:1 Minority enrollment: 42%
Show 100 more public schools in Salt Lake County, UT (out of 323 total schools)
Loading...
[+] Show Closed Public Schools in Salt Lake County, UT

Salt Lake County Public Schools (Closed)

School
Location
Quick Facts
2500 South State St
Salt Lake City, UT 84115
(385) 646-4666
Gr: 7-12
Opening August 2
Herriman, UT 84096
(801) 878-8622
Gr: K-6
420 E South Temple, Suite 200
Salt Lake City, UT 84111
(801) 953-1157
Gr: K-8 | 392 students
2500 South State St
Salt Lake City, UT 84115
(385) 646-5000
Gr: K-6 | 4 students Student-Teacher Ratio: 4:1 Minority enrollment: 74%
2500 South State St
Salt Lake City, UT 84115
(385) 646-5000
Gr: 9-12 | 21 students Student-Teacher Ratio: 21:1 Minority enrollment: 61%
2500 South State St
Salt Lake City, UT 84115
(385) 646-5000
Gr: 7-9 | 26 students Student-Teacher Ratio: 26:1 Minority enrollment: 49%
4998 S. Galleria Drive
Salt Lake City, UT 84123
(801) 989-7191
Gr: K-12 | 1,335 student Student-Teacher Ratio: 19:1 Minority enrollment: 27%
450 East 3700 South
Salt Lake City, UT 84115
(385) 646-4680
Gr: 7-12
3809 W 6200 S
Salt Lake City, UT 84118
(801) 963-4300
Gr: 7-12 | 47 students Student-Teacher Ratio: 47:1 Minority enrollment: 17%
175 W 7200 S
Midvale, UT 84047
(801) 565-6832
Gr: 9-12 | 23 students Minority enrollment: 9%
9800 S 800 E
Sandy, UT 84094
(801) 826-7750
Gr: K-5 | 266 students Student-Teacher Ratio: 20:1 Minority enrollment: 35%
2935 S 8560 W
Magna, UT 84044
(385) 646-5134
Gr: 7-9 | 931 students Student-Teacher Ratio: 23:1
3900 S 5325 W
West Valley City, UT 84120
(385) 646-5008
Gr: PK-6
3660 South West Temple
Salt Lake City, UT 84115
(801) 284-3300
Gr: K-6 | 3 students
2415 E 7600 S
Salt Lake City, UT 84121
(801) 944-2934
Gr: K-6 | 327 students Student-Teacher Ratio: 16:1 Minority enrollment: 12%
179 E 5065 S
Salt Lake City, UT 84107
(801) 264-7470
Gr: 9-12 | 107 students Minority enrollment: 26%
2310 West 2770 South
West Valley City, UT 84119
(385) 954-9203
Gr: 10-12
Dream Charter School (Closed 2006)
Alternative School
Charter School
2900 S State Suite 301
Salt Lake City, UT 84115
(801) 467-1500
Gr: 9-12 | 44 students Minority enrollment: 46%
5500 Bagley Park Rd.
West Jordan, UT 84081
(801) 282-1143
3775 West 6020 South
Salt Lake City, UT 84118
(385) 964-7555
Gr: 1-6 | 165 students Student-Teacher Ratio: 28:1 Minority enrollment: 16%
14178 South Pony Express Rd
Draper, UT 84020
(801) 576-6714
Gr: 7-12
3690 South 3600 West
West Valley City, UT 84119
(385) 646-5320
350 East 3605 South
Salt Lake City, UT 84115
(385) 646-4585
Gr: 9-12 | 2 students Student-Teacher Ratio: 1:1
3305 South 500 East
Salt Lake City, UT 84106
(385) 646-5340
Gr: 9-12
382 East 3605 South
Salt Lake City, UT 84115
(385) 646-4526
Gr: 7-12 | 18 students Student-Teacher Ratio: 3:1 Minority enrollment: 44%
340 S Goshen
Salt Lake City, UT 84104
(801) 531-6100
Gr: K-3 | 83 students Student-Teacher Ratio: 42:1 Minority enrollment: 93%
Hartvigsen School (Closed 2023)
Special Education School
W 3605 S
West Valley City, UT 84119
(801) 646-4585
Gr: K-12 | 221 students Student-Teacher Ratio: 11:1 Minority enrollment: 18%
Hartvigsen School (Closed 2023)
Special Education School
350 E 3605 S
Salt Lake City, UT 84115
(801) 646-4585
Gr: K-12 | 221 students Student-Teacher Ratio: 11:1 Minority enrollment: 18%
1675 S 600 E
Salt Lake City, UT 84105
(801) 481-4824
Gr: K-6 | 318 students Student-Teacher Ratio: 19:1 Minority enrollment: 36%
3031 South 200 East
Salt Lake City, UT 84115
(385) 646-5174
Gr: K-12
4405 S 1025 E
Salt Lake City, UT 84124
(801) 263-6110
Gr: PK-6 | 402 students Minority enrollment: 30%
2500 South State St
Salt Lake City, UT 84115
(385) 646-5000
Gr: PK-6 | 10 students Minority enrollment: 40%
2500 South State St
Salt Lake City, UT 84115
(385) 646-5000
Gr: 7-12 | 22 students Minority enrollment: 32%
Home Hospital (Closed 2013)
Alternative School
9361 South 300 East
Sandy, UT 84070
(801) 501-1354
Gr: K-12
2500 South State St
Salt Lake City, UT 84115
(385) 646-4631
Gr: 7-9
Show 52 more closed public schools in Salt Lake County, UT (out of 87 total schools)
Loading...

Frequently Asked Questions

What are the top ranked public schools in Salt Lake County, UT?
The top ranked public schools in Salt Lake County, UT include Sunrise School, Cottonwood School and Howard R. Driggs School.
How many public schools are located in Salt Lake County?
323 public schools are located in Salt Lake County.
What percentage of students in Salt Lake County go to public school?
94% of all K-12 students in Salt Lake County are educated in public schools (compared to the UT state average of 97%).
What is the racial composition of students in Salt Lake County?
Salt Lake County public schools minority enrollment is 41% of the student body (majority Hispanic), which is more than the Utah public schools average of 29% (majority Hispanic).
Which public schools in Salt Lake County are often viewed compared to one another?

Recent Articles

Opinion: Handcuffing in Public Schools is a Gateway to More Violence
Opinion: Handcuffing in Public Schools is a Gateway to More Violence
Some districts are banning handcuffing, while others are cuffing kindergarteners simply throwing a temper tantrum. Read this editorial to see why this author believes slapping the cuffs on children’s wrists only leads to more behavior issues and violence in their adult lives.
Whooping Cough: Should Vaccinations be Required for Public School Enrollment?
Whooping Cough: Should Vaccinations be Required for Public School Enrollment?
Whopping cough is making a comeback, especially amongst children, prompting health officials to encourage pertussis vaccines and boosters. However, should the pertussis vaccine be required for public school enrollment? Learn about current proposed laws and its ramifications.
What are Common Core Standards and Why Do We Need Them?
What are Common Core Standards and Why Do We Need Them?
With schools nationwide adopting common core standards, we’ll take a look at what they are, their benefits, and how they will change the face of public education.